Description

No. 3 St Mary's Lane is an early 19th-century building constructed of colour-washed stone rubble with brick dressings. It has one storey plus an attic and features a gable to the left with a corbelled and dentilled verge, which is also echoed at the eaves. The building includes one later casement window set in a brick surround with a pointed arched head, along with two lower windows and a plain doorway, all sharing a similar design. The roof is covered with tiles.
